Output 6ac676a90fc6d763d24e8110d4c61a4b37725ac6606617632f45fe805bd59a95:3

value
2540258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bac9bde4c6a180eee7f5b9610929db5db762e10 OP_EQUAL
address
378YZwDmY1HorsLGUieiQgvKwHomPbgjwD
transaction
6ac676a90fc6d763d24e8110d4c61a4b37725ac6606617632f45fe805bd59a95
spent
true